Abstract
Methods and compositions for restoring growth inhibition sensitivity to a tumor cell resistant to growth inhibition by HER2 antagonists. The methods involve administering a PCDGF antagonist to the cell in an amount effective to stimulate or restore growth inhibition sensitivity to HER2 antagonists. The invention also provides treatment regimens, and therapeutic compositions comprising an HER2 antagonist and a PCDGF antagonist.
